Angel - Willem de Roo Radio Edit BPM

Since Angel - Willem de Roo Radio Edit by The Madison, Simon J, Aelyn, Willem de Roo has a tempo of 132 beats per a minute, the tempo markings of this song would be Allegro (fast, quick, and bright). With Angel - Willem de Roo Radio Edit being at 132 BPM, the half-time would be 66 BPM with a double-time of 264 BPM.In addition, we consider the tempo speed to be pretty fast for this song. This makes this song perfect for activities such as, walking.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

Angel - Willem de Roo Radio Edit Key

This song has a musical key of B Major. Or for those who are familiar with the camelot wheel, this song has a camelot key of 1B. So, the perfect camelot match for 1B would be either 1B or 2A. While, 2B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 10B and a high energy boost can either be 3B or 8B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 1A or 12B will give you a low energy drop, 4B would be a moderate one, and 11B or 6B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 10A allows you to change the mood.
